The Robinette Company to Install its 2nd W&H NOVOFLEX C Flexo Press
After purchasing a NOVOFLEX CL last year, Robinette this time opts for the NOVOFLEX CM.

LINCOLN, RI, August 2006 – Windmoeller & Hoelscher Corporation announces the sale of a 53” NOVOFLEX CM 10-color flexo press to the Robinette Company of Bristol, TN. The press will be
shipped to the customer’s Bristolplant in October for installation in November of this year.

Robinette decided to invest in a second NOVOFLEX press because it is in need of additional capacity as it continues making inroads in the flexible packaging markets. According to Bristol, TN Facility Plant Manager, Gil Graham, “We are investing in new printing equipment as part of our plan to create one of
the most modern flexiblepackaging plants in the country.”

Last September, Robinette installed its first W&H press, the NOVOFLEX CL, with much success,
“The press is performing as promised, and the service shown both during installation and afterwards
has been world class.” Pleased with both the CL press and W&H, Robinette considers the purchase
of second NOVOFLEX press to be a ‘natural progression’ as it looked ahead for additional printing capacity. This fall the company will welcome a NOVOFLEX CM to its Bristol facility.

“We feel a CM press is a perfect compliment to our existing CL,” explains Graham. “The CL offers a
larger repeat range (49”), allowing us to compete in markets that were once closed. Now, having a
CM repeat range (34.5”) fits our current product mix perfectly.”

The Robinette Company was established in 1987, but traces its roots back to 1938 when Judge Robinette began printing and converting small paper bags to supply the flour and corn millers of the Eastern U.S. Today, the Robinette Company is a full-service flexible packaging and specialty converting manufacturer committed to serving the food, beverage, construction, textile and health care markets.

The 53” NOVOFLEX CM sold to Robinette has a max. repeat length of 34.5” and is equipped with
the EASY-SET fully automatic impression setting system; PORT-A-SLEEVE sleeve handling system
to facilitate fast and easy changing of plate cylinder and anilox roll sleeves; and TURBOCLEAN fully automatic ink supply and wash-up system. Capacity on the new press will be allocated towards
high-end flexo printing for laminated substrates such as roll stock, pouches and heat shrink.

The NOVOFLEX CM and NOVOFLEX CL printing presses make up W&H’s NOVOFLEX C series
– the latest generation of sleeved, direct drive, CI flexo presses. These presses are designed for both wider printing widths and increased repeat lengths, allowing customers to choose between W&H’s wide web cylinder technology or wide web sleeve technology. The NOVOFLEX CM is available in 8 or 10 colors with repeat lengths of 49” and 34.5” respectively. The NOVOFLEX CL is a 10-color press with max. repeats of 49”. Both presses have printing widths of 35” – 87” and a max. line speed of 2000 fpm.

Windmoeller & Hoelscher is a leader in the design, manufacture and distribution of flexographic and gravure printing presses, blown and cast film extrusion systems, multi-wall equipment, plastic sack and bag making machines, as well as form-fill-seal machinery for the converting and packaging industry.
